티스토리 뷰
자바 api 에 있는 Scanner class method 입니다.
메소드의 개요 | |
---|---|
void | close () 현재의 스캐너를 클로즈 합니다. |
Pattern | delimiter () 이 Scanner 가 단락지어 문자의 매칭에 현재 사용하고 있는 Pattern 를 돌려줍니다. |
String | findInLine (Pattern pattern) 단락 문자를 무시해, 다음에 나타나는 지정된 패턴의 검색을 시도합니다. |
String | findInLine (String pattern) 단락 문자를 무시해, 다음에 나타나는, 지정된 캐릭터 라인으로부터 구축된 패턴의 검색을 시도합니다. |
String | findWithinHorizon (Pattern pattern, int horizon) 다음에 나타나는 지정된 패턴의 검색을 시도합니다. |
String | findWithinHorizon (String pattern, int horizon) 단락 문자를 무시해, 다음에 나타나는, 지정된 캐릭터 라인으로부터 구축된 패턴의 검색을 시도합니다. |
boolean | hasNext () 이 스캐너가 입력내에 다른 토큰을 보관 유지하는 경우는 true 를 돌려줍니다. |
boolean | hasNext (Pattern pattern) 다음의 완전한 토큰이 지정된 패턴에 일치하는 경우는 true 를 돌려줍니다. |
boolean | hasNext (String pattern) 다음의 토큰이, 지정된 캐릭터 라인으로부터 구축된 패턴에 일치하는 경우는 true 를 돌려줍니다. |
boolean | hasNextBigDecimal () 이 스캐너의 입력내의 다음의 토큰이, nextBigDecimal() 메소드를 사용해 BigDecimal 치로서 해석 가능한 경우에, true 를 돌려줍니다. |
boolean | hasNextBigInteger () 이 스캐너의 입력내의 다음의 토큰이, nextBigInteger() 메소드를 사용해 디폴트의 기수의 BigInteger 치로서 해석 가능한 경우에, true 를 돌려줍니다. |
boolean | hasNextBigInteger (int radix) 토큰을 정수로서 해석하기 위해서 사용하는 기수 이 스캐너의 다음의 토큰이 유효한 BigInteger 인 경우에게만, true 이 스캐너가 클로즈 하고 있는 경우 |
boolean | hasNextBoolean () 캐릭터 라인 「true|false」로부터 작성된 대문자와 소문자의 구별되지 않는 패턴을 사용해, 스캐너의 입력내의 다음의 토큰을 boolean 치로서 해석 가능하면, true 를 돌려줍니다. |
boolean | hasNextByte () 이 스캐너의 입력내의 다음의 토큰이, nextByte() 메소드를 사용해 디폴트의 기수의 byte 치로서 해석 가능한 경우에, true 를 돌려줍니다. |
boolean | hasNextByte (int radix) 이 스캐너의 입력내의 다음의 토큰이, nextByte() 메소드를 사용해 지정된 기수의 byte 치로서 해석 가능한 경우에, true 를 돌려줍니다. |
boolean | hasNextDouble () 이 스캐너의 입력내의 다음의 토큰이, nextDouble() 메소드를 사용해 double 치로서 해석 가능한 경우에, true 를 돌려줍니다. |
boolean | hasNextFloat () 이 스캐너의 입력내의 다음의 토큰이, nextFloat() 메소드를 사용해 float 치로서 해석 가능한 경우에, true 를 돌려줍니다. |
boolean | hasNextInt () 이 스캐너의 다음의 토큰이 유효한 int 치인 경우에게만, true 이 스캐너의 다음의 토큰이 유효한 int 치인 경우에게만, true 이 스캐너가 클로즈 하고 있는 경우 |
boolean | hasNextInt (int radix) 이 스캐너의 입력내의 다음의 토큰이, nextInt() 메소드를 사용해 지정된 기수의 int 치로서 해석 가능한 경우에, true 를 돌려줍니다. |
boolean | hasNextLine () 이 스캐너의 입력에 다른 행이 있는 경우는 true 를 돌려줍니다. |
boolean | hasNextLong () 이 스캐너의 다음의 토큰이 유효한 long 치인 경우에게만, true 이 스캐너가 클로즈 하고 있는 경우 |
boolean | hasNextLong (int radix) 이 스캐너의 입력내의 다음의 토큰이, nextLong() 메소드를 사용해 지정된 기수의 long 치로서 해석 가능한 경우에, true 를 돌려줍니다. |
boolean | hasNextShort () 이 스캐너의 다음의 토큰이 디폴트 기수에 근거하는 유효한 short 치인 경우에게만, true 이 스캐너가 클로즈 하고 있는 경우 |
boolean | hasNextShort (int radix) 이 스캐너의 입력내의 다음의 토큰이, nextShort() 메소드를 사용해 지정된 기수의 short 치로서 해석 가능한 경우에, true 를 돌려줍니다. |
IOException | ioException () 이 Scanner 의 기본으로 되는 Readable 가 마지막에 throw 한 IOException 를 돌려줍니다. |
Locale | locale () 현재의 스캐너의 로케일을 돌려줍니다. |
MatchResult | match () 이 스캐너가 실행한 마지막 스캔 조작의 매칭 결과를 돌려줍니다. |
String | next () 이 스캐너로부터 다음의 완전한 토큰을 검색해 돌려줍니다. |
String | next (Pattern pattern) 지정된 패턴에 일치하는 다음의 토큰을 돌려줍니다. |
String | next (String pattern) 다음의 토큰이 지정된 캐릭터 라인으로부터 구축된 패턴에 일치하는 경우에게만, 그것을 돌려줍니다. |
BigDecimal | nextBigDecimal () 입력의 다음의 토큰을 BigDecimal 로서 스캔 합니다. |
BigInteger | nextBigInteger () 입력의 다음의 토큰을 BigInteger 로서 스캔 합니다. |
BigInteger | nextBigInteger (int radix) 입력의 다음의 토큰을 BigInteger 로서 스캔 합니다. |
boolean | nextBoolean () 입력의 다음의 토큰을 boolean 치로서 스캔 해, 그 값을 돌려줍니다. |
byte | nextByte () 입력의 다음의 토큰을 byte 로서 스캔 합니다. |
byte | nextByte (int radix) 입력의 다음의 토큰을 byte 로서 스캔 합니다. |
double | nextDouble () 입력의 다음의 토큰을 double 로서 스캔 합니다. |
float | nextFloat () 입력의 다음의 토큰을 float 로서 스캔 합니다. |
int | nextInt () 입력의 다음의 토큰을 int 로서 스캔 합니다. |
int | nextInt (int radix) 입력의 다음의 토큰을 int 로서 스캔 합니다. |
String | nextLine () 스캐너를 현재행의 끝에 진행해, 스킵 한 입력을 돌려줍니다. |
long | nextLong () 입력의 다음의 토큰을 long 로서 스캔 합니다. |
long | nextLong (int radix) 입력의 다음의 토큰을 long 로서 스캔 합니다. |
short | nextShort () 입력의 다음의 토큰을 short 로서 스캔 합니다. |
short | nextShort (int radix) 입력의 다음의 토큰을 short 로서 스캔 합니다. |
int | radix () 현재의 스캐너의 디폴트 기수를 돌려줍니다. |
void | remove () Iterator 의 구현이 remove 오퍼레이션을 지원하지 않는 경우 |
Scanner | reset () 현재의 스캐너를 리셋 합니다. |
Scanner | skip (Pattern pattern) 지정된 패턴에 일치하는 입력을, 단락 문자를 무시해 스킵 합니다. |
Scanner | skip (String pattern) 지정된 캐릭터 라인으로 구축된 패턴에 일치하는 입력을 스킵 합니다. |
String | toString () 이 Scanner 의 캐릭터 라인 표현을 돌려줍니다. |
Scanner | useDelimiter (Pattern pattern) 이 스캐너의 단락 문자 패턴을, 지정된 패턴으로 설정합니다. |
Scanner | useDelimiter (String pattern) 이 스캐너의 단락 문자 패턴을, 지정된 String 로부터 작성된 패턴으로 설정합니다. |
Scanner | useLocale (Locale locale) 스캐너의 로케일이 지정된 로케일로 설정합니다. |
Scanner | useRadix (int radix) 스캐너의 디폴트 기수가 지정된 기수로 설정합니다. |
'IT > Java' 카테고리의 다른 글
[Java] Scanner클래스 예제 . 주민번호 앞자리 추출하는 프로그램 (0) | 2014.03.21 |
---|---|
[Java] 대소문자 변환 프로그램 (0) | 2014.03.21 |
[Java] 간단한 입력클래스 (0) | 2014.03.20 |
[Java] 클래스 만들기 예제. (0) | 2014.03.13 |
1.자바 시작하기 (0) | 2014.03.07 |